Market Dynamics
A mix of tech leaps, green mandates, and consumer hunger drives the Wireless Power Transmission Market. Governments worldwide are mandating EV adoption and net-zero goals, creating subsidies and standards that boost wireless charging infrastructure. Think Europe’s push for dynamic road charging or the U.S. DOE’s investments—these policies are supercharging growth.
Innovation is the real spark. Advances in high-frequency resonators, gallium nitride chips, and beamforming tech have slashed energy loss to under 10% over distances, making long-range transmission viable. Pair that with 5G integration for precise power steering, and costs are plummeting—down 30% in the last two years alone.
Challenges persist, though: regulatory hurdles on electromagnetic safety, high upfront costs for infrastructure, and scaling far-field tech without interference. Battery limits in receivers also slow some apps. But with R&D pouring in from Big Tech and startups, plus falling component prices, these hurdles are fading fast, setting up explosive expansion.

Key Players Analysis
Powerhouses like Emrod, WiTricity, PowerLight Technologies, Energous, Ossia, Qualcomm, Samsung, and TDK are leading the charge. WiTricity dominates near-field EV charging with its magnetic resonance systems, powering partnerships with GM and Toyota for production vehicles. Emrod shines in long-range microwave beaming, trialing utility-scale power delivery in New Zealand.
Qualcomm and Energous focus on consumer gadgets, embedding wireless tech in phones and wearables for Qi2-standard charging. Samsung and TDK innovate in compact resonators for IoT, while PowerLight pushes laser-based systems for drones and satellites. The scene buzzes with mergers, like WiTricity’s deals with automakers, and open standards to avoid patent wars—everyone’s racing to own the invisible grid.
Regional Analysis
North America leads, thanks to EV giants like Tesla and policy firepower from the Bipartisan Infrastructure Law. The U.S. hums with pilots for highway wireless charging, while Canada’s cold-weather tests expand reach.
Europe’s hot on the heels, with the EU’s Green Deal funding megawatt-scale projects in Germany and the UK. Sweden’s dynamic road trials show EVs zipping along powered wirelessly.
Asia-Pacific steals the show for volume—China’s BYD and state-backed labs crank out affordable modules, Japan’s Sony refines consumer tech, and India’s solar-wireless hybrids target rural power. The Middle East eyes desert solar beaming to grids.

Recent News & Developments
2025 brought breakthroughs: WiTricity rolled out factory-integrated wireless charging for Proterra buses, hitting 95% efficiency. Emrod beamed 550W over 1.8km in a UK demo, eyeing commercial grids. Energous snagged FCC approval for 1W far-field charging in medical implants.
Qualcomm partnered with Bosch for automotive standards, and China’s Huawei unveiled a 50kW laser system for drones. Startups like Reach Power raised $100M for space-to-Earth transmission. Momentum’s building toward trillion-dollar potential.
